New client site! Check out Vanishing Paradise, which I designed and built for the National Wildlife Federation and that aims to get hunters and anglers involved in saving Louisiana’s wetlands (hence all the guns — they don’t call this audience the “hook and bullet crowd” for nothing).

The site’s built in WordPress and integrates with a DemocracyInAction account for list-building. It’s pretty straightforward overall, though dig the (client-requested) slideshow in the top banner, done with a publicly available Javascript. The site’s recently launched and is still a little shy on the content front, but the client is already working to expand it. A fun project all around.
